Question: I have facial numbness on my left side. Is that from a stroke or congestion? I've been diagnosed with bronchitis and sinusitis.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Dr. Ivan Romich (13 minutes later)
Brief Answer:
hi and welcome

Detailed Answer:
This is definitely not stroke especially in such young people. This is very probably caused by sinusitis which causes surrounding oedema that presses sensory nerves in this area. Also sinusitis can cause temporary paresis of facial nerve . You should treat it as any other sinusitis and congestion with antibiotics,decongestants and anti-inflammatory drugs and this will improve. Also,apply warm compresses on this area.
